Output 532fb6f93d5298b9a91fcd4b96c07df912e781a536ebde0c94c5f6c1c6d642ae:0

value
1662191
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aa68956a924593b864625a0c1f98098679bb804 OP_EQUAL
address
3HFLJK4skhPtqnxFvgzdvXUYDmFX87kswg
transaction
532fb6f93d5298b9a91fcd4b96c07df912e781a536ebde0c94c5f6c1c6d642ae
confirmations
117251
spent
true